Show moreDiscover the fascinating and intricately woven tale of one of history's most powerful figures with this enchanting book about Marie Laveau, the legendary voodoo queen of New Orleans. Written with passion and meticulous research, it serves not only as a deep dive into her life but also as a profound exploration of the mystical practices surrounding her legacy. The author, a respected academic rooted in the Creole tradition, unveils the myths and realities of Laveau, offering a rich tapestry of cultural history intertwined with voodoo rituals.
This unique volume stands out because it goes beyond mere storytelling; it illuminates the spiritual essence of Laveau's life and how she harnessed her power in a society that sought to diminish her. In a time when women, particularly women of color, faced horrendous oppression, Laveau emerged as a beacon of spiritual authority and agency. The book acknowledges the African roots of spiritual practices, reminding readers of the magnificent legacy that has shaped much of modern mysticism.
Not only does the text provide historical context, but it also invites readers into Laveau's world, sharing rituals that allow for personal connection and empowerment. With its engaging narrative, readers will find themselves inspired to explore their own spiritual paths, learning from Laveau's profound understanding of life's energies and vibrations.
